Job Description
Job Objective
- The job holder will support academic, research, and administrative functions within the department, including preparing and directly interacting with students during lab, discussion, quiz, or problem/challenge-based learning sessions under the guidance of the supervisor.
Teaching and Learning
- Assist lecturers in preparing teaching materials, tutorials, and coursework.
- Facilitate discussion groups, tutorials, or practical sessions where required.
- Support marking of assignments, tests, and examinations under supervision.
- Provide academic support and guidance to students.
Research Coordination
- Administer colloquium programs.
- Engage in research activities, including literature reviews, data collection, and analysis.
- Help with research projects, including preparing reports, presentations, and grant development.
Administrative and Student Support
- Assist departments in maintaining student records and data entry.
- Support in organising departmental activities, including seminars, workshops, guest lectures and ceremonies.
- Assist in organising students’ activities.
- Provide student support and Services and refer them to support services as appropriate.
- Supervise undergraduate interns where applicable.
Qualifications And Experience
- Must be currently enrolled in a Master’s Degree program at KCA University.
- Must have attained a First-Class Honours degree in either Business, Procurement, Economics, Statistics or any other relevant undergraduate program offered at the School of Business, KCA University.
- Demonstrated interest in research, teaching or consultancy
